  • 2013 Louis Roederer Champagne Cristal Brut 94 Points

    France, Champagne

    Magnum. More serious and concentrated than the bottles of 15 side-by-side. Concentrated orchard fruit with toasted nuts, brioche and a hint of citrus oil in the finish. I think this is better than the '15 but perhaps a little less overt at this stage. Upside from here.

  • 2010 Domaine Dujac Morey-Saint-Denis 91 Points

    France, Burgundy, Côte de Nuits, Morey-Saint-Denis

    Magnum. Wide open and full nose of red and black cherry, spice and whole cluster. The palate is round and supple with perhaps a bit less punch than the nose. Delicious and in the middle of a peak window.

  • 2017 Domaine Dujac Gevrey-Chambertin 1er Cru Aux Combottes 93 Points

    France, Burgundy, Côte de Nuits, Gevrey-Chambertin 1er Cru

    Full nose has a lot going on with black cherry, meat spice and whole cluster. Palate has round, plush fruit that has 1er+ concentration. Good structure that still needs time but is proportional the fruit. All in harmony and drinking nicely but this should improve with age. Per Jeremy, the last "normal" vintage after a run of vintages with extreme (solar levels of heat, hail, etc.) challenges - and it shows in the completeness and confidence of the wine.

  • 2008 Domaine Dujac Clos de la Roche 95 Points

    France, Burgundy, Côte de Nuits, Clos de la Roche Grand Cru

    Gorgeous full, intense aromas of red and black cherry, toasted herbs, emerging earth, spice and whole cluster. The palate has excellent concentration of youthful fruit. Harmonious acids give lift but otherwise go unnoticed. Still in an early peak drinking window.

  • 1995 Domaine Dujac Bonnes Mares 95 Points

    France, Burgundy, Côte de Nuits, Bonnes Mares Grand Cru

    Magnum. Lifted, full aromas of black cherry, earth and intense whole cluster. The palate is both serious and now approachable. Structure still present but feels fine and well-integrated with the fruit. Solidly at peak.

  • 1996 Domaine Dujac Clos de la Roche 96 Points

    France, Burgundy, Côte de Nuits, Clos de la Roche Grand Cru

    Wow, gorgeous nose that beams with mature red fruit and intense whole cluster. Fruit is both fresh and dried in nature with tannins that are fine and acidity that is juicy and fresh. A mature CdlR that is cruising along in a peak drinking window.

  • 2003 Domaine Dujac Clos de la Roche 93 Points

    France, Burgundy, Côte de Nuits, Clos de la Roche Grand Cru

    Downright delicious and handled the vintage well, though clearly there is more ripeness (in fruit flavor profile and mouthfeel). Enough freshness to keep the bold, ripe fruit from being overbearing. A nice foil for A-5 miyazaki wagyu.

  • 2014 Domaine Dujac Puligny-Montrachet 1er Cru Les Combettes 93 Points

    France, Burgundy, Côte de Beaune, Puligny-Montrachet 1er Cru

    Magnum. Wow, this is so fresh and youthful and downright delicious. Orchard fruit, lemon cream and melons with a bit of well-integrated reduction and toast. Loads of bright acidity that matches the fruit. A long life ahead out of this format.

  • 2022 Trailside Vineyard Cabernet Sauvignon Trailside Vineyard 92 Points

    USA, California, Napa Valley, Rutherford

    Night cap following the Dujac wines. This is a restrained and classically proportioned Napa cabernet with the added bonus of 10% whole cluster. Young cab is never easy but this drinks with youthful pleasure and accessibility. Fruit is medium weight and structure is refined. Still early and will take some time to integrate but a lot to like about the philosophy and early results. Upside from here, I suspect.
